Abstract

The article presents a discussion of the paper "Making use of brace overstrength to improve the seismic response of multistorey split-X concentrically braced steel frames." The authors point out some inconsistencies present in the paper. They note that the first series of structures studied were designed without inclusion of P-delta effects that were included in the subsequent analyses. In addition, they contend that the lower base shear forces mandated by the 2005 National Building Code of Canada (NBCC) compared with those in the 1990 NBCC make P-delta effects more critical than earlier requirements are not insignificant.
